Right at the end of this episode there was the cameo appearance of a character seen two times during the classic series (Specifically in the Pertwee Era.) "Alpha Centauri". Alpha appeared in "The Curse of Peladon" and "The Monster of Peladon" in the early 70's opposite the Ice Warriors and Jon Pertwee's 3rd Doctor. That was a very awesome callback for those of us who've seen those episodes. Alpha Centauri was/is an Hermaphrodite Hexapod, a multi limbed, green being with one big eye on its head. A female voice artist was cast to do her voice, but there was a man inside the bodysuit on the original show, kind of adding to the gender neutral nature of the character. Centauri was kind of an amusing ambassador character, so it was nice to have her/it back in the new series. (Alpha Centauri has also appeared in the Big Finish audio adventure "The Bride of Peladon" with the 5th Doctor.)
